While doing remapping at HC (GRU) with Brian, Serge and Xavier we're
setting up our JOSMs to reserve more memory (so we won't into the annoying
Out of Memory error messages that sometimes cause data loss and are always
a nuisance).

In Windows you need to simply create a shortcut with (more or less) the
following information:

* Name: whatever you want (I use JOSM tested - because that's what I'm
running)
* Target: [path to your java.exe]\java.exe -jar -Xmx[amount of
memory]M (e.g. I have C:\WINDOWS\system32\java.exe -jar -Xmx512M)  "[path
to your JOSM .jar file]\josm-tested.jar"  (e.g. I have "C:\Documents and
Settings\User\Desktop\josm-tested.jar")
... So, my Target field reads:  C:\WINDOWS\system32\java.exe -jar
-Xmx512M C:\Documents and Settings\User\Desktop\josm-tested.jar
* Start in: [Java.exe directory] -- I have: C:\Windows\System32\

That's it!
